Five reasons to pick up our January/February issue

Introducing our Jan/Feb issue!

There are a hundred reasons to read our latest edition, out in shops now; here are just five!

It’s a brand new year, and we have a sparkling new issue out in shops now. Our January/February edition is jam-packed with content, lovingly created to inspire and inform. Here are Team ICM’s top picks. We hope you enjoy!

Doireann Garrihy

Photography Naomi Gaffey Styling Corina Gaffey Assisted by Orlaigh King Hair Norma Jean at The Room Hair Co Makeup Orlaith Shore using Charlotte Tilbury With thanks to Grey Area Studio

The broadcaster chatted to Klara Heron about all things Dancing with the Stars; from how she was initially asked to be a contestant on the show, to her quiet confidence in how she knew she could get the job as co-host. Doireann opened up about entering her 30s, and how so far it’s her happiest era yet, especially having just purchased her own first-ever home. She tells Irish Country Magazine about the renovation plans for the house in Castleknock which she will live in with her dog Bertie, and how a female architect, also in her 30s, is helping to bring her vision to life. The 2FM radio star also revealed that it’s not just her career enjoying success – her love life is, too: “Romantic love wasn’t part of my plan for 2023 but as all the best lyricists and poets will tell you, you can’t plan for that kind of thing.”

Small house inspiration

Photography Claire Nash Words by Niamh Devereux

We were invited into presenter Bláthnaid Treacy’s home in Stoneybatter, Dublin for an in-depth-look at her gorgeous renovation. Bláthnaid and her musician husband Charlie Moon transformed the house they’ve been living in for years – but just bought in 2020 – by knocking down walls and implementing smart hacks to make use of their limited space. The result is a quirky, cosy home, filled with art, colour and plush furniture.

The great escape

We bring you countless new ideas for your 2023 travels, whether it’s romantic stays in Ireland, going off-grid with new concept Slow Cabins, or the international destinations that everyone will be talking about this coming year, from Zakynthos, Greece to Izmir, Turkey.

Game-changing beauty

If you’re looking for ways to elevate your beauty routine in the new year, these pages are for you. Aisling Keenan outlines the beauty innovations that are changing the game, from tech devices to clever haircare, while we have all the details on new launches, including an Irish skincare brand making its products from foraged wild herbs and plants.

Meaningful stories

Leading transformation coach Niamh Ennis shares an extract from hew new book, where she admits how she became “addicted to sympathy” at one point in her life, and outlines how she became unstuck from that painful era. Niamh Devereux talks to Women’s Aid on its new campaign Too Into You, which aims to help young women from getting swept up in toxic relationships, and Ariana Dunne shares the experiences and lessons from a magical year spent travelling and working across Europe.

For all this and more, get your new issue today. Happy new year!
